Ready for an Italian idyll? Villa Le Maschere is a majestic, honey-colored villa perched on a Tuscan hillside, offering a 5-star retreat with attentive service and luxurious amenities. Located about 30 miles from Florence, the property provides a peaceful contrast to the bustle of the city. Its long history includes visits from notable figures such as King Carlo Felice, Pope Pius IX and Carlo Emanuele IV, King of Sardinia. Built in the late 16th century, the villa is a member of the Small Luxury Hotels of the World. The name “Maschere,” meaning “masks,” refers to the decorative mask reliefs beneath the roofline along the front facade.
Part of the Una Hotels & Resorts collection, the villa showcases significant artistic and decorative work by Florentine masters. Guests will find paintings and decorative details by Tito Chini and Francesco Furini, carvings by Giovanni Battista Foggini, and majolica from the Chini factory in nearby Borgo San Lorenzo. Each of the 65 rooms and suites is unique, with individual color schemes, period furnishings and hand-crafted elements such as frescoes, gesso moldings and stucco. Some rooms open through French doors onto the gardens; junior suites may include mezzanines; and one suite even features gold-leafed floors and walls. Subtle playfulness appears in select rooms through touches like orange upholstery, mint-green trim or a bright red stair rail, blending classical elegance with contemporary character.
The grounds feature terraced gardens and broad tree-lined avenues ideal for strolling or quiet reflection. The lower-level spa and wellness center offers a sauna, steam bath and an emotional shower with multiple color settings and spray levels. A large jetted tub with bench seating and waterfall elements leads to an outdoor swimming pool, creating a seamless indoor-outdoor experience. The spa menu uses Sothys products and includes hydrating and anti-aging facials, a variety of massage therapies, and curated programs focused on regenerating, rebalancing, hydrating and purifying.
Practical comforts include a complimentary shuttle to and from Florence city center, making cultural excursions easy while preserving the villa’s tranquil setting. Mornings feature breakfast served in a sunlit room or, in the warmer months, on a multilevel terrace that overlooks the gardens and parkland. Evenings at the villa center on traditional Tuscan and Mugello cuisine served at Il Piopponero, where guests can enjoy regional specialties in an inviting atmosphere.
